Does anyone know of anywhere local or national that fixes Kindles?

I think mine my need a new battery, I would prefer to have it checked though before spending the money on a new battery and trying to fix it myself.

I had a Kindle in for "repair" over the weekend, customer said it was completely dead, another place had told her it was water damaged.

Turned out the charger (original) wasn't high enough amperage to start the charging process when it was completely flat.

Fiver for a 2A USB charger later and one VERY happy lady.

The battery on a Kindle shouldn't be failing yet unless its one of the early ones.

What is the actual problem that you're having with it ?

I have had my Kindle for 2 years but I havent used my kindle for a few weeks. Last week I took it out of the cover and there was a message on it stating that the battery was empty and needed charging for at least 30 minutes to clear the screen of the message. If this didnt work it said to reset it. I tried the above and nothing happened.

After chatting with Kindle Customer Care they suggested another wire/plug. I plugged it in to another socket and after an hour or so it worked. So I thought it was fixed. I am trying to get hold of another wire as we "chat"!.

But no it keeps freezing, and then resetting itself. When you reset it it only works if you have just charged it. The slide button underneath shows no green light and when I manage to get it on you cannot slide to close the kindle into sleep mode.

I have checked the version number and it is up to date.

Have a feeling it isnt holding its charge but I am happy to be proved wrong!!
